3. Impact on forest policy: 3.5 Corporate social responsibility<br />

3.5.1 The Russian forestry sector<br />

Focused on Russia, Ptichnikov <strong>and</strong> Park (2005) summarize:<br />

“The comb<strong>in</strong>ation of these factors is creat<strong>in</strong>g a favorable external driv<strong>in</strong>g force for CSR<br />

<strong>and</strong> certification <strong>in</strong> the Russian forest sector which is 70% oriented towards export, with<br />

55% of those exports oriented to-wards the ecologically sensitive markets of the European<br />

Union <strong>and</strong> North America. The Russian <strong>in</strong>ternal market, through some DIY outlets (IKEA,<br />

Obi), also shows an <strong>in</strong>terest <strong>in</strong> CSR products, but on a m<strong>in</strong>or scale. Certification has become<br />

a driv<strong>in</strong>g force of best practice <strong>in</strong> the Russian forest sector. Certification is:<br />

Sector wide ((…) certified by <strong>FSC</strong> scheme – 12% of commercial forests)<br />

Transparent (due to publicly available certification reports, three chamber equal weight<br />

<strong>and</strong> stakeholder consultations)<br />

Aimed at shar<strong>in</strong>g governance (Government <strong>and</strong> corporate sector partnerships <strong>in</strong><br />

different areas)<br />

Targeted at reduc<strong>in</strong>g <strong>in</strong>efficiencies (e.g. legislative barriers)<br />

Implement<strong>in</strong>g management systems <strong>and</strong> measures of productivity ga<strong>in</strong>s<br />

Captur<strong>in</strong>g market based benefits (trade <strong>in</strong> certified products, ethical <strong>in</strong>vestments).<br />

The ma<strong>in</strong> environmental effect (of <strong>FSC</strong> certification <strong>in</strong> Russia) is the conservation <strong>and</strong><br />

enhancement of biodiversity. The ma<strong>in</strong> social improvement of certification under <strong>FSC</strong> is<br />

the implementation of the health <strong>and</strong> safety guidel<strong>in</strong>es at the site level. The ma<strong>in</strong><br />

economic improvement effected by certification under <strong>FSC</strong> is the enhancement of the<br />

quality of forest management plann<strong>in</strong>g, <strong>in</strong>clud<strong>in</strong>g appropriate documentation, monitor<strong>in</strong>g<br />

<strong>and</strong> the verification of the long-term susta<strong>in</strong>ability of the actual harvest<strong>in</strong>g volume. (…)<br />

Certification provides a significant boost for improv<strong>in</strong>g silvicultural operations <strong>in</strong> Russia, but<br />

<strong>in</strong>ternationally acceptable CSR practice will only be achieved if this is comb<strong>in</strong>ed with modern<br />

policies <strong>and</strong> the improvement of legislation <strong>and</strong> governance. Investment <strong>in</strong> silvicultural<br />

improvements is only reasonable where a responsible leaseholder has overall responsibility<br />

for the complete forest management cycle.” 376<br />
